Milton + Esperanza
Esperanza Spalding · 2024
60 min · 16 tracks · funk · jazz · soul
A vibrant fusion of jazz, funk, and soul that celebrates cultural heritage through intricate melodies and rhythms.
Why this album works
This album is significant for its ambitious collaboration with Brazilian musician Milton Nascimento, which garnered critical acclaim and highlighted the merging of American jazz with Brazilian musical traditions. Its influence was evident in revitalizing interest in cross-cultural music collaborations within the contemporary jazz scene.

- Context
- Released on August 9, 2024, 'Milton + Esperanza' marks Esperanza Spalding's artistic evolution following her Grammy-winning project '12 Little Spells'. At this point in her career, she had established herself as a boundary-pushing artist, blending genres and exploring complex themes, positioning this album as a celebration of Brazilian music and culture.
